INSTALL ENGINE REAR OIL SEAL
Apply MP grease to the lip of a new oil seal.
Note
Do not allow foreign matter to contact the lip of the oil seal.
Do not allow MP grease to contact the dust seal.
Using SST and a hammer, tap in the oil seal until its surface is flush with the edges of the cylinder block and crankcase.
Note
Wipe off any extra grease from the crankshaft.
Do not tap in the oil seal at an angle.

INSTALL FLYWHEEL SUB-ASSEMBLY (for Manual Transaxle)
Using SST, hold the crankshaft.
Clean the bolts and bolt holes.
Apply adhesive to 2 or 3 threads at the end of the 8 bolts.
| *1 | Adhesive |
| Adhesive |
|---|
| Toyota Genuine Adhesive 1324, Three Bond 1324 or equivalent |
Uniformly install and tighten the 8 bolts in several steps in the sequence shown in the illustration.
Mark the top of the bolts with paint.
Retighten the 8 bolts an additional 90° in the same sequence.
Check that the paint marks are now at a 90° angle to the top.

INSTALL CLUTCH COVER ASSEMBLY (for Manual Transaxle)
| *1 | Matchmark |
| *2 | Temporarily Install |
Align the matchmark on the clutch cover assembly with the one on the flywheel sub-assembly.
Following the order shown in the illustration, tighten the 6 bolts, starting with the bolt located near the knock pin at the top.
Tech Tips
Following the order in the illustration, tighten the bolts evenly one at a time.
Move SST up and down, right and left lightly after checking that the clutch disc assembly is in the center, and tighten the bolts.
INSPECT AND ADJUST CLUTCH COVER ASSEMBLY (for Manual Transaxle)
Using a dial indicator with a roller instrument, check the diaphragm spring tip alignment.
| Maximum non-alignment |
|---|
| 0.5 mm (0.0196 in.) |
If the alignment is more than the maximum, using SST, adjust the diaphragm spring tip alignment.
